Estimating the Cost of Ewallet App Development with Cutting-Edge Features

Feb 15




  • Share this article on Facebook
  • Share this article on Twitter
  • Share this article on Linkedin

In the digital age, ewallet apps have become a staple for convenient transactions. The cost of developing such an app with advanced features can vary widely, influenced by factors like required functionalities, chosen platforms (Android, iOS, or both), and the geographic location of the development team. Typically, the price range for creating an ewallet app can span from $30,000 to $100,000. This article delves into the intricacies of ewallet app development costs, highlighting the impact of various features and market trends on the overall investment.


The Surge of Ewallet Apps in the Digital Economy

The digital revolution has transformed the way we access services,Estimating the Cost of Ewallet App Development with Cutting-Edge Features Articles with mobile applications bringing convenience right to our fingertips. This shift has been particularly evident in the financial sector, where fintech innovations have spurred significant growth. According to a McKinsey report, the investment in fintech is projected to surpass $30 billion by 2020. Mobile payments are at the forefront of this expansion, with the global eWallet market expected to reach a staggering $13,979 billion in transactions by 2022, a significant leap from the $4,296 billion recorded in 2018 (Payments Cards & Mobile).

User Engagement in the Ewallet App Market

The success stories of mobile payment platforms like M-Pesa, Paytm, and Samsung Pay have set benchmarks in the industry. Paytm, for instance, boasts over 350 million registered users as of May 2019. On the global stage, WeChat Pay leads with 600 million users, followed by Alipay's 400 million users. These figures underscore the potential and reach of ewallet applications.

Diverse Payment Integration Methods in Ewallet Apps

Ewallet apps offer various methods for users to conduct transactions seamlessly:

NFC Technology

Near Field Communication (NFC) enables users to make contactless payments by simply tapping their phone against an NFC-enabled terminal. Samsung Pay is a prime example of an app utilizing NFC for smooth transactions.

QR Codes

QR codes facilitate payments between users, even if the recipient's contact details are not saved in the sender's phone. Scanning a QR code is a quick and efficient way to transfer funds.

Bluetooth and iBeacon

iBeacon, introduced by Apple, and Bluetooth technology allow for proximity-based transactions and services. These technologies are widely adopted in ewallet solutions for their speed and security.

Payment Apps

Payment apps cater to businesses by streamlining transactions between partners and enabling large transfers in a secure environment without third-party involvement.


Blockchain technology is renowned for its security and immutability, making it a popular choice for government organizations and apps handling substantial financial transactions.

Key Features of a Mobile Wallet App

Ewallet apps typically consist of two main components: the user panel and the admin panel, each with distinct functionalities.

User Panel Features

  • Registration/Customer Onboarding: Adhering to KYC regulations, users can upload identity documents directly within the app.
  • Connect Bank Account: Users can link their bank accounts for future transactions.
  • Add Money: An automated feature allows users to add funds from their bank to the wallet.
  • Transfer Funds: Money can be sent using account details or mobile numbers.
  • Accept Payments: Payments are received via QR code or mobile number.
  • Mobile Recharge and Bill Payments: Users can pay bills and recharge mobile phones directly from the app.
  • Transaction History: The app maintains a record of all user transactions.
  • Booking Tickets: Users can book travel and event tickets with ease.
  • Bank to Bank Transfer: Direct transfers to bank accounts are facilitated through the app.
  • Paying for Taxes or Insurance: The app enables easy payment of taxes and insurance premiums.
  • Online Shopping: Users can shop for a variety of products without leaving home.
  • Exciting Offers: Regular discounts and offers attract and retain customers.
  • Multi-Language Support: Users can navigate the app in their preferred language.

For a comprehensive guide on secure and robust ewallet app development, consider exploring resources like Nimble AppGenie's guide.

Admin Panel Features

  • Dashboard: Admins can monitor user activity and personalize the dashboard.
  • Offers and Discounts: Admins manage promotions and discounts.
  • Manage Users and Contacts: User data is tracked and monitored.
  • Real-Time Analytics: Transaction data and app usage are analyzed.
  • Block Users: Admins can block users based on behavior.

Additional Features

  • USSD Payments: Essential for markets with limited smartphone penetration, such as Africa.
  • QR Code Reader: Simplifies transactions by scanning QR codes.
  • Virtual Cards: Users can create and use virtual cards for transactions.
  • In-App Camera: Facilitates document uploads and QR code scanning.
  • Push Notifications: Keeps users informed about updates and offers.

Understanding Financial Regulations

Developing an ewallet app requires adherence to banking and financial regulations. It's crucial to understand the legal framework and ensure the app's compliance with government guidelines.

Technology Stack for Ewallet App Development

The choice of technology stack can influence the development cost. Here's a breakdown of potential technologies:

  • SMS, Voice, and Phone Verification: Nexmo
  • Payment: Braintree, PayPal, Stripe, E-Wallets, E-Banking, PayUMoney
  • Database: MongoDB, MySQL, HBase, Cassandra, PostgreSQL, MailChimp Integration
  • Front End: jQuery, Angular, JavaScript, CSS, HTML5, Bootstrap
  • Cloud Environment: AWS, Azure, Google Cloud, Salesforce, Cloud Foundry
  • Real-Time Analytics: Hadoop, Spark, Big Data, Apache, Flink, Cisco, IBM
  • Push Notifications: Twilio, Push.IO, Amazon SNS, Urban Airship, Map, AdPushup
  • Data Management: Datastax
  • Emails: Mandrill
  • QR Code Scanning: ZBar Bar Code Reader

Cost Breakdown of Ewallet App Development

The cost of developing an ewallet app is contingent on several factors, including the complexity of features, the development platform, and the location of the development team. For instance, companies in Australia may charge around $190 per hour, while those in Europe and North America might charge $130 and $150 per hour, respectively. A basic wallet app could cost between $25,000 to $50,000, while more advanced apps with features like bill payment integration could range from $75,000 to $100,000.


Ewallet apps have revolutionized financial transactions, making them more accessible and efficient. As the industry continues to grow, investing in ewallet app development can be a lucrative venture for startups and established businesses alike. With the right development partner and a clear understanding of the market, you can create an app that stands out in the competitive fintech landscape.

Also From This Author

The Comprehensive Guide to Mobile Banking App Development

The Comprehensive Guide to Mobile Banking App Development

In the digital age, mobile banking apps have become a necessity for financial institutions aiming to provide convenient and accessible services to their customers. With the rise of mobile technology and the impact of the COVID-19 pandemic accelerating the shift towards digital banking, financial organizations are increasingly investing in mobile app development. This guide outlines a detailed seven-step process for creating a successful mobile banking application, incorporating the latest industry insights and security measures to meet customer expectations and regulatory requirements.
Crafting a Premier Stock Market Website: A Guide Inspired by TradingView

Crafting a Premier Stock Market Website: A Guide Inspired by TradingView

In the digital age, the finance industry has embraced technology to meet evolving market demands. Stock market websites have become essential tools for investors and brokers, offering a range of services from investment tracking to real-time trading. With platforms like TradingView setting the standard, creating a competitive stock market website requires a blend of innovative technology, user-friendly design, and comprehensive market data. This guide will walk you through the process of developing a stock market website that stands out in the crowded digital landscape.
Essential Features for Your Peer-to-Peer Lending Application

Essential Features for Your Peer-to-Peer Lending Application

Peer-to-peer (P2P) lending is a revolutionary approach to obtaining loans, offering an alternative to traditional banking and credit union loans. In this system, loans are granted using the assets deposited by other customers, rather than the bank's own resources. P2P lending apps have made the lending and borrowing process more convenient, providing a win-win situation for both borrowers and investors. This article will delve into the key features your P2P lending app should have, the benefits of P2P lending, and the process of obtaining a loan through these apps.